Swedish climate activist Greta Thunberg, 20, was arrested on Tuesday during a protest on the sidelines of an oil and gas industry conference in London.

As a photographer from the AFP news agency reported, the 20-year-old was taken by two police officers and placed in the back seat of a police car. Several hundred demonstrators had previously blocked all entrances to the hotel where the Energy Intelligence Forum is taking place until Thursday.

As a participant in the protest, Thunberg criticized agreements between politicians and oil and gas industry representatives as “closed deals.” “Behind these closed doors, spineless politicians make deals and compromises with the lobbyists of the destructive fossil fuel industry,” she told reporters.

The world is drowning in fossil fuels. “Our hopes, dreams and lives are being washed away by a flood of greenwashing and lies,” Thunberg added.

A number of market leaders were scheduled to speak at the conference on Tuesday, including Shell boss Wael Sawan (49), his counterpart at the French TotalEnergies Patrick Pouyanne (60) and the head of Saudi Aramco, Amin Nasser (65). . The protesters denounced that most of the industry’s profits would be funneled back into dirty energy, worsening climate change.

Thunberg is seen as the face of the global climate movement. As a 15-year-old, the Swede started sitting in front of the Swedish parliament in Stockholm during class on Friday and demonstrating for more effective climate protection measures.

Within a few months, their weekly strike expanded into the global Fridays for Future protest movement. Thunberg has now ended her school strikes now that she has graduated. (AFP)
